mirror of
https://github.com/msberends/AMR.git
synced 2025-07-08 07:51:57 +02:00
(v0.9.0.9012) Support for LOINC codes
This commit is contained in:
@ -85,7 +85,7 @@
|
||||
</button>
|
||||
<span class="navbar-brand">
|
||||
<a class="navbar-link" href="../index.html">AMR (for R)</a>
|
||||
<span class="version label label-default" data-toggle="tooltip" data-placement="bottom" title="Latest development version">0.9.0.9010</span>
|
||||
<span class="version label label-default" data-toggle="tooltip" data-placement="bottom" title="Latest development version">0.9.0.9012</span>
|
||||
</span>
|
||||
</div>
|
||||
|
||||
@ -253,6 +253,8 @@
|
||||
|
||||
<span class='fu'>ab_atc_group2</span>(<span class='no'>x</span>, <span class='kw'>language</span> <span class='kw'>=</span> <span class='fu'><a href='translate.html'>get_locale</a></span>(), <span class='no'>...</span>)
|
||||
|
||||
<span class='fu'>ab_loinc</span>(<span class='no'>x</span>, <span class='no'>...</span>)
|
||||
|
||||
<span class='fu'>ab_ddd</span>(<span class='no'>x</span>, <span class='kw'>administration</span> <span class='kw'>=</span> <span class='st'>"oral"</span>, <span class='kw'>units</span> <span class='kw'>=</span> <span class='fl'>FALSE</span>, <span class='no'>...</span>)
|
||||
|
||||
<span class='fu'>ab_info</span>(<span class='no'>x</span>, <span class='kw'>language</span> <span class='kw'>=</span> <span class='fu'><a href='translate.html'>get_locale</a></span>(), <span class='no'>...</span>)
|
||||
@ -332,18 +334,18 @@ The <a href='lifecycle.html'>lifecycle</a> of this function is <strong>maturing<
|
||||
<span class='fu'>ab_name</span>(<span class='st'>"AMX"</span>) <span class='co'># "Amoxicillin"</span>
|
||||
<span class='fu'>ab_atc</span>(<span class='st'>"AMX"</span>) <span class='co'># J01CA04 (ATC code from the WHO)</span>
|
||||
<span class='fu'>ab_cid</span>(<span class='st'>"AMX"</span>) <span class='co'># 33613 (Compound ID from PubChem)</span>
|
||||
|
||||
<span class='fu'>ab_synonyms</span>(<span class='st'>"AMX"</span>) <span class='co'># a list with brand names of amoxicillin</span>
|
||||
<span class='fu'>ab_tradenames</span>(<span class='st'>"AMX"</span>) <span class='co'># same</span>
|
||||
|
||||
<span class='fu'>ab_group</span>(<span class='st'>"AMX"</span>) <span class='co'># "Beta-lactams/penicillins"</span>
|
||||
<span class='fu'>ab_atc_group1</span>(<span class='st'>"AMX"</span>) <span class='co'># "Beta-lactam antibacterials, penicillins"</span>
|
||||
<span class='fu'>ab_atc_group2</span>(<span class='st'>"AMX"</span>) <span class='co'># "Penicillins with extended spectrum"</span>
|
||||
|
||||
<span class='co'># smart lowercase tranformation</span>
|
||||
<span class='fu'>ab_name</span>(<span class='kw'>x</span> <span class='kw'>=</span> <span class='fu'><a href='https://rdrr.io/r/base/c.html'>c</a></span>(<span class='st'>"AMC"</span>, <span class='st'>"PLB"</span>)) <span class='co'># "Amoxicillin/clavulanic acid" "Polymyxin B"</span>
|
||||
<span class='fu'>ab_name</span>(<span class='kw'>x</span> <span class='kw'>=</span> <span class='fu'><a href='https://rdrr.io/r/base/c.html'>c</a></span>(<span class='st'>"AMC"</span>, <span class='st'>"PLB"</span>),
|
||||
<span class='kw'>tolower</span> <span class='kw'>=</span> <span class='fl'>TRUE</span>) <span class='co'># "amoxicillin/clavulanic acid" "polymyxin B"</span>
|
||||
|
||||
<span class='co'># defined daily doses (DDD)</span>
|
||||
<span class='fu'>ab_ddd</span>(<span class='st'>"AMX"</span>, <span class='st'>"oral"</span>) <span class='co'># 1</span>
|
||||
<span class='fu'>ab_ddd</span>(<span class='st'>"AMX"</span>, <span class='st'>"oral"</span>, <span class='kw'>units</span> <span class='kw'>=</span> <span class='fl'>TRUE</span>) <span class='co'># "g"</span>
|
||||
<span class='fu'>ab_ddd</span>(<span class='st'>"AMX"</span>, <span class='st'>"iv"</span>) <span class='co'># 1</span>
|
||||
@ -351,12 +353,13 @@ The <a href='lifecycle.html'>lifecycle</a> of this function is <strong>maturing<
|
||||
|
||||
<span class='fu'>ab_info</span>(<span class='st'>"AMX"</span>) <span class='co'># all properties as a list</span>
|
||||
|
||||
<span class='co'># all ab_* functions use as.ab() internally:</span>
|
||||
<span class='fu'>ab_name</span>(<span class='st'>"Fluclox"</span>) <span class='co'># "Flucloxacillin"</span>
|
||||
<span class='fu'>ab_name</span>(<span class='st'>"fluklox"</span>) <span class='co'># "Flucloxacillin"</span>
|
||||
<span class='fu'>ab_name</span>(<span class='st'>"floxapen"</span>) <span class='co'># "Flucloxacillin"</span>
|
||||
<span class='fu'>ab_name</span>(<span class='fl'>21319</span>) <span class='co'># "Flucloxacillin" (using CID)</span>
|
||||
<span class='fu'>ab_name</span>(<span class='st'>"J01CF05"</span>) <span class='co'># "Flucloxacillin" (using ATC)</span>
|
||||
<span class='co'># all ab_* functions use as.ab() internally, so you can go from 'any' to 'any':</span>
|
||||
<span class='fu'>ab_atc</span>(<span class='st'>"AMP"</span>) <span class='co'># ATC code of AMP (ampicillin)</span>
|
||||
<span class='fu'>ab_group</span>(<span class='st'>"J01CA01"</span>) <span class='co'># Drug group of ampicillins ATC code</span>
|
||||
<span class='fu'>ab_loinc</span>(<span class='st'>"ampicillin"</span>) <span class='co'># LOINC codes of ampicillin</span>
|
||||
<span class='fu'>ab_name</span>(<span class='st'>"21066-6"</span>) <span class='co'># "Ampicillin" (using LOINC)</span>
|
||||
<span class='fu'>ab_name</span>(<span class='fl'>6249</span>) <span class='co'># "Ampicillin" (using CID)</span>
|
||||
<span class='fu'>ab_name</span>(<span class='st'>"J01CA01"</span>) <span class='co'># "Ampicillin" (using ATC)</span>
|
||||
|
||||
<span class='co'># spelling from different languages and dyslexia are no problem</span>
|
||||
<span class='fu'>ab_atc</span>(<span class='st'>"ceftriaxon"</span>)
|
||||
|
Reference in New Issue
Block a user